From 9e6d0574627fa60a16659019f033b3ccac3e6249 Mon Sep 17 00:00:00 2001 From: Daniel Scalzi Date: Wed, 21 Aug 2019 22:28:08 -0400 Subject: [PATCH] Remove unneeded promise in DistributionStructure. --- src/model/struct/distribution.struct.ts | 14 ++++++-------- 1 file changed, 6 insertions(+), 8 deletions(-) diff --git a/src/model/struct/distribution.struct.ts b/src/model/struct/distribution.struct.ts index fdd135c..ef9b652 100644 --- a/src/model/struct/distribution.struct.ts +++ b/src/model/struct/distribution.struct.ts @@ -19,14 +19,12 @@ export class DistributionStructure implements ModelStructure { await this.serverStruct.init() } - public async getSpecModel() { - return new Promise(async (resolve) => { - resolve({ - version: '1.0.0', - rss: '', - servers: await this.serverStruct.getSpecModel() - }) - }) as Promise + public async getSpecModel(): Promise { + return { + version: '1.0.0', + rss: '', + servers: await this.serverStruct.getSpecModel() + } } }